About This Item

The Detective Book Club produced volumes of three crime novels from 1942 to 1999. Originally monthly, near the end they dwindled down to just a few per year. Many famous detective and crime novelists had their early works featured in DBC editions. Often, books were published in DBC editions before, or at the same time as they were published in mass market form. A little about our authors:

Marian Babson: Babson had a writing career that ran from 1971 to 2012. She passed away in 2017. She wrote three short detective series, the longest being the seven edition Trixie and Evangeline series, but Babson also wrote 32 stand alone detective novels. Altogether Babson published 45 novels. This novel was also published as Miss Petunia's Last Case.

George Baxt:
A playwright, scriptwriter and novelist, Baxt's first novel introduced the genre's first Black and gay detective, Pharoah Love, who appeared in five novels. He also wrote thirteen novels featuring sleuth Jacob Singer, each involving Hollywood celebrities as characters. Baxt died in 2003. This is the final Singer novel.

Susan Holtzer: One of the more challenging authors to gather information about. My usual source had nothing, and it took a bit of digging to get just a little more. She has no web page, seems to shun the limelight and hasn't published since 2002. Between 1994 and 2001, Holtzer published seven Anneke Haagen mysteries, all set at the University of Michigan. Her only other books are two non-fiction releases, one on the history of the U of M student newspaper, and the other a collection of anecdotes from workers on San Francisco cable cars. The latter was published in 2002 and seems to coincide with a move from Michigan to California. Born in 1940, I suppose she's retired now. This is the fourth Haagen novel.
